As part of Save The Waves’ work to preserve the surfing coastline, we are implementing the next phase of work to protect the coast and ocean in south central Chile. This campaign, entering its second year, is called “Fuerza Chile! United for Clean Water,” and focuses on building the capacity of communities and local organizations to serve as the stewards of coastal and marine resources.

We are working with our Chilean partners, including the Maule Itata Coastkeeper, to hold multiple beach cleanups on March 23, 2013 from 10am – 2pm in Pichilemu, Punta de Lobos, Loanco, Curanipe and Cobquecura simultaneously. The main purpose is to not only conduct a large-scale cleanup of beaches and rivers in each location, but to also educate community members about the importance of stewardship and involve them in other activities to protect the coast and ocean such as water quality monitoring and advocacy.
